Обзор компании
Наша портфельная компания — это быстрорастущий стартап, специализирующийся на креативных технологиях с использованием искусственного интеллекта. Мы разрабатываем инновационные решения для аниме-индустрии, включая генератор изображений из текста для создания высококачественных визуальных материалов в стиле аниме, чат-ботов на базе ИИ для интерактивного контента и социальную платформу с курируемыми пользовательскими материалами, связанными с аниме. Имея более 10 000 ежедневных активных пользователей, мы активно стремимся увеличить нашу пользовательскую базу в 10-20 раз в течение следующих шести месяцев за счет стратегической разработки продуктов и технологических усовершенствований.
Описание вакансии
Эта роль предполагает руководство проектированием, разработкой и развертыванием основных программных систем, которые обеспечивают работу наших продуктов на базе ИИ. Идеальный кандидат будет отвечать за определение технического направления нашей платформы, сотрудничество с кросс-функциональными командами для реализации функций, соответствующих бизнес-целям, и продвижение инноваций в области генеративного ИИ. Вы будете тесно работать с менеджерами продуктов, дизайнерами и специалистами по данным, чтобы технические решения соответствовали потребностям пользователей и бизнес-требованиям.
Ключевые обязанности
- Обеспечение технического лидерства для определения и реализации улучшений продуктовой дорожной карты с учетом бизнес-целей и обратной связи пользователей
- Руководство полным циклом разработки функций или проектов, включая анализ требований, проектирование архитектуры, кодирование, тестирование и развертывание
- Сотрудничество с продуктовыми и маркетинговыми командами для понимания сути и причин новых инициатив, проведение маркетинговых исследований и конкурентного анализа
- Исследование и представление технических решений с различными компромиссами между производительностью, масштабируемостью и сроками разработки
- Постоянная оценка и оптимизация существующего технологического стека, выявление возможностей для улучшений и внедрение новых технологий
- Разработка и поддержка масштабируемых бэкенд-систем для наших приложений ИИ, обеспечивающих высокую доступность и производительность для растущей пользовательской базы
- Сотрудничество с инженерами по обеспечению качества для разработки стратегий тестирования и гарантии качества продукта через строгие процессы тестирования
- Участие в код-ревью, наставничество младших инженеров и поддержка лучших практик разработки программного обеспечения
- Мониторинг метрик производительности системы и реализация стратегий оптимизации для улучшения пользовательского опыта
- Отслеживание новых технологий ИИ и отраслевых трендов для стимулирования инноваций в наших продуктах
Требования к кандидату
- Подтвержденный опыт работы инженером-программистом с сильной экспертизой в full-stack разработке и технологиях ИИ
- Глубокие знания Python, JavaScript и связанных языков программирования с пониманием фреймворков машинного обучения
- Опыт работы с облачными платформами (AWS/GCP) и технологиями контейнеризации (Docker/Kubernetes) для масштабируемых развертываний
- Сильные знания веб-технологий, включая REST API, GraphQL и современные фронтенд-фреймворки
- Способность руководить кросс-функциональными командами и одновременно управлять несколькими проектами с четким приоритизированием
- Отличные навыки решения проблем с опытом своевременной реализации сложных технических решений
- Сильные коммуникативные навыки для эффективного взаимодействия с продуктовыми, дизайнерскими и бизнес-командами
- Опыт работы с agile-методологиями и CI/CD-процессами для эффективной поставки ПО
- Понимание практик DevOps и концепций инфраструктуры как кода для автоматизированного развертывания
- Способность работать в динамичной стартап-среде с акцентом на быстрые итерации и инновации
- Сильные аналитические навыки для интерпретации данных и принятия обоснованных технических решений
- Опыт работы с технологиями генерации изображений и моделями глубокого обучения для креативных приложений ИИ
- Знание систем баз данных (SQL/NoSQL) и решений для хранения данных при работе с большими объемами пользовательской информации
- Умение создавать техническую документацию и объяснять сложные концепции нетехническим стейкхолдерам
- Опыт работы с системами контроля версий (Git) и практиками совместной разработки
- Внимание к деталям и стремление писать чистый, поддерживаемый код
- Способность адаптироваться к изменяющимся требованиям и приоритизировать функции на основе бизнес-эффекта
- Опыт проведения A/B-тестирования и работы с аналитическими инструментами для оценки эффективности функций
- Знание лучших практик безопасности и нормативов по защите данных для приложений ИИ